The handle locking cap on the Snoopy Sno Cone machine has a design flaw that causes it to lock clockwise in the same direction as the handle rotation. When a piece of ice jams against the lock, the pressure twists the cap in the opposite direction, causing it to pop off repeatedly during each sno cone making session. I wanted a locking cap that attaches in the opposite direction for added reliability. There's another Snoopy Sno Cone locking cap design that I wasn't aware of when I created this one. It doesn't seem to be prone to the same issue as the original, using a different mechanism altogether. My design is a faithful replica of the original, but with the locking direction reversed for improved performance. Instructions: Print the model with the handle facing upwards. Only the outer overhang needs to be supported by your slicer's support placement if you can control it precisely.
